At best it's a way for teams to trade 'problems' Not that I'm advocating for this by any stretch but here are a few theories as to why they could be interested (if there's anything to this): - If Galchenyuk's agent indicates he's likely to file for arbitration and a short-term deal, that will take him within a year of UFA status which gives him a lot of leverage in contract talks moving forward. Drouin still has four years of team control. With four RFA years versus two, a long-term deal should come in cheaper for Drouin than Galchenyuk. - Drouin has played a little bit of centre in the past - maybe they envision that he could make the transition now. - Drouin doesn't hesitate to shoot - he's more of a pure trigger man than Galchenyuk who tends to look for the more creative play at times. Montreal doesn't exactly have a lot of pure shooters at any position up front so this may be of interest to them.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
